Birni N’Konni vs Pedernales Climate & Distance Between

Dominican Republic flag
  • The distance between Birni N’Konni, Niger and Pedernales, Dominican Republic is approximately 8,187 km or 5,088 mi.
  • To reach Birni N’Konni in this distance one would set out from Pedernales bearing 80.5°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Birni N’Konni bearing 105.1° or ESE .
  • Both have a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h).
  • Birni N’Konni is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Pedernales is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 1.3 °C (2.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.8 °C (10.4°F) more in Birni N’Konni.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 19.6 mm (0.8 in) less which is equivalent to 19.6 l/m² (0.48 US gal/ft²) or 196,000 l/ha (20,954 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2° higher in Birni N’Konni than in Pedernales.
